Gender equality is the state where all individuals, regardless of gender, enjoy equal rights, opportunities, responsibilities, and protections in all spheres of life, including work, politics, and the home. It means fair access to resources, freedom from discrimination, and the ability to live free from violence or harmful stereotypes.
